Lama in the "Space City" museum (2000)

(3 min 20 sec sequence - no sound)

This one is not very illustrative, as it only shows Lama roving without any visual explanation of the involved algorithms. It was recorded in the garden of the Cité de l'Espace museum of Toulouse, during a week-end organized within the temporary "Destination Mars" exposition. It was the first time that Lama evolved autonomously in public: very impressed, Lama was not in its best shape, and only accepted to evolve slowly, wavering along its paths.
